Gasholder Station Kennington Oval London Lambeth SE11 5SG Data via plota.co.uk
Description
Partial approval of details pursuant to condition 37 (Block B only - Secured by Design Residential) of planning permission ref : as amended by , ((Variation of Conditions 2 (Approved Plans), 4 (CHP ), 17(Cycle Parking), 41(Energy System Emission)and 75 (Quantum of Development)) of planning permission (Variation of Planning Permission ref: as amended by ref: , 21/03922/NMC, 21/03055/NMC 22/00420/NMC (Variation of Planning Permission ref : 17/05772/EIAFUL as amended by S96A ref: 20/00646/NMC (Demolition of existing buildings and structures including temporary disassembly of listed gas holder no.1, demolition of locally-listed gas holders 4 and 5, redevelopment to provide a mixed-use development comprising re-erection of restored gas-holder no.1, erection of new buildings ranging from 4-18 storeys to provide residential (Class C3), office (Class B1) incorporating ancillary cafe and space for community use, waste management use and community space (Class D1)) dated 31/01/2024… Data via plota.co.uk

Lambeth ranks #164 out of 296 councils for householder decision speed. 47% of applications have the time limit extended, above the 41% national average. Lambeth is also one of the strictest councils - it refuses more householder applications than almost any other, with only 81% approved vs 90% nationally.
